BUG/MINOR: init: properly detect NUMA bindings on large systems
The NUMA detection code tries not to interfer with any taskset the user
could have specified in init scripts. For this it compares the number of
CPUs available with the number the process is bound to. However, the CPU
count is retrieved after being applied an upper bound of MAX_THREADS, so
if the machine has more than 64 CPUs, the comparison always fails and
makes haproxy think the user has already enforced a binding, and it does
not pin it anymore to a single NUMA node.
